Local Events: Salone del Mobile 2008 Milan

International design and furniture collide at this year’s Salone del Mobile trade show. Salone 2008 started earlier this week and runs until April 21. Billed as the world’s largest design trade show, you don’t want to miss this if you’re in the area. It’s a great place to view innovative and upcoming designs within the realm of furniture and accessories.

The show opens up to the general public this Sunday (April 20) and Wallpaper has a great podcast covering the event. It includes information and tips for getting around town. These tips shouldn’t be taken lightly. The popularity of the show draws an enormous amount of tourists to Milan each year. It’s been recorded that an extra 270,000 tourists come to the area during the event, which means crowded streets, hotels and cabs. So go prepared. Wallpaper Coverage of Salone del Mobile & Jaime Hayon’s Jet Set for Bisazza

”’This year it’s all about the spectacle,’ said Jaime Hayon, hours before his Jet Set installation for Bisazza was opened to the press. And spectacle it certainly is. Through the rubble of wrapping and rumble of hoovers that drowned the Tortona stands this afternoon, Hayon’s aircraft was spectacular…”
